American Legion Post 282 on University Avenue in La Mesa has served the region's veterans continuously since its charter date of June 28, 1923, making it one of the oldest veteran posts in San Diego's East County. The facility at 8118 University Avenue houses Post 282 alongside VFW O.K. Ingram Ship 1774, Sons of the American Legion Squadron 282, and Air Force Sergeants Association Chapter 1365, a multi-organization campus that hosts catered events supplied by La Mesa kitchens including Aromas of India. The recently remodeled upper banquet hall seats 200 with a maximum capacity of 299 and includes a full theatrical stage, commercial kitchen, and bar for private rentals including corporate events, weddings, and community ceremonies. Post 282 owns and maintains California's first Vietnam Veterans Memorial, constructed in 1970 and rededicated on Flag Day 2014 at the intersection of University Avenue and Spring Street.
